Gillis<\/a> and <a href=\"https:\/\/www.techtarget.com\/contributor\/John-Moore\">John Moore<\/a><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p> Small and medium-sized businesses (SMBs), nonprofits and government agencies hire MSPs to perform a defined set of day-to-day management services. These services may include network and infrastructure management, security and monitoring.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>MSPs often handle management services on a daily basis so customer organizations can focus on improving their services without worrying about extended system downtimes or service interruptions.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>While some MSPs may specialize in specific segments of IT, such as data storage, others focus on specific vertical markets, such as legal, financial services, healthcare or manufacturing. Managed security service providers, for instance, offer specialized types of services, such as remote firewall administration and other security-as-a-service offerings.\u00a0Managed print service\u00a0providers maintain printers and supply consumables. ASPs helped pave the way for cloud computing and companies that would provide remote support for customers&#8217; IT infrastructure. MSPs initially focused on the remote monitoring and management (RMM) of servers and networks. Over time, they have expanded the scope of their services as a way to differentiate themselves from other providers.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Today, the terms\u00a0<em>cloud service provider<\/em>\u00a0and\u00a0<em>managed service provider<\/em>\u00a0are sometimes used synonymously when the provider&#8217;s service is supported by a service-level agreement (SLA) and is delivered over the internet.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-embed is-type-video is-provider-youtube wp-block-embed-youtube wp-embed-aspect-16-9 wp-has-aspect-ratio\"><div class=\"wp-block-embed__wrapper\">\nhttps:\/\/youtu.be\/Hp2IuJeteBk\n<\/div><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>What are MSPs used for?<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Hiring a managed service provider can help an organization improve its operations.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>SMBs are typical MSP customers. Communication between the MSP and the organization typically begins with an assessment that determines the organization&#8217;s current environment. This assessment may point out potential room for improvement and how to properly support business goals.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>There is not one specific setup for every organization, so an MSP may provide many different service options. Two examples of MSP offerings are technical support fix services and subscription services.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>MSP technical support fix services focus on remotely fixing or sending technicians to a business&#8217;s location to resolve any issues. MSPs that provide this option charge the company for the time spent\u00a0troubleshooting\u00a0and for any parts used to repair the problem.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>MSPs that offer a\u00a0subscription service model\u00a0work on the quality of service of an organization&#8217;s network and usually bill customers monthly. If an issue arises, the MSP will fix the problem as part of the agreement between the organization and the MSP. Payment through the subscription model is based on defined rates per computer or equipment.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Maintenance, security, monitoring, reporting and other services are defined using an SLA that documents what the organization can expect from the MSP. Response times, performance and security specifications are also included in the service agreement.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>MSPs may deliver their own native services, other providers&#8217; services or an integrated mix of the two. Pure-play MSPs specifically focus on one vendor or technology and more commonly offer their own native services.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>MSPs also focus on deploying specialist software platforms that automatically manage functions. The SLA spells out the performance and quality metrics that govern the relationship. Organizations need to be precise when agreeing on the commitments they make in SLA contracts.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>An SLA may be linked to an MSP&#8217;s pricing formula. For example, an MSP may offer a range of SLAs to customers, with the customer paying a higher fee for higher levels of service in a tiered pricing structure.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>What are the types of MSPs?<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>The types of managed service providers can differ depending on the criteria chosen to categorize them. Such pricing methods let MSPs sell services under a\u00a0subscription model. This approach provides the MSP with a\u00a0monthly recurring revenue (MRR) stream, in contrast to IT projects that tend to be one-time transactions.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>MRR differs from other business models, as providers pursuing the break\/fix model, for example, usually price their services on a time and materials basis. They generally bill an hourly rate for repairing a customer&#8217;s IT equipment and charge for parts or replacement gear.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-embed is-type-video is-provider-youtube wp-block-embed-youtube wp-embed-aspect-16-9 wp-has-aspect-ratio\"><div class=\"wp-block-embed__wrapper\">\nhttps:\/\/youtu.be\/U0RYZdmhQlw\n<\/div><\/figure>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p><span class=\"span-reading-time rt-reading-time\" style=\"display: block;\"><span class=\"rt-label rt-prefix\">Reading Time-approximately:<\/span> <span class=\"rt-time\"> 6<\/span> <span class=\"rt-label rt-postfix\">minutes<\/span><\/span>A managed service provider (MSP) is a third-party company that remotely manages a customer&#8217;s information technology (IT) infrastructure and end-user systems.
